College Coaching Career
Billy Donovan's coaching career began at the collegiate level, where he quickly made a name for himself as a visionary leader. In 1996, he accepted the head coaching position at the University of Florida, a decision that would change the trajectory of his career.
University of Florida Success
Under Donovan's leadership, the University of Florida men's basketball team achieved unprecedented success. He guided the team to two consecutive NCAA national championships in 2006 and 2007, becoming one of only a handful of coaches to achieve this feat. His ability to recruit top-tier talent and develop players into NBA-ready prospects solidified his reputation as one of the best college coaches in the country.
- 2006 NCAA National Championship
- 2007 NCAA National Championship
- Four Final Four Appearances
NBA Coaching Journey
In 2015, Billy Donovan made the transition to professional basketball, accepting the head coaching position with the Oklahoma City Thunder. This move marked a significant chapter in his career, as he transitioned from the collegiate level to the fast-paced world of the NBA.

Oklahoma City Thunder
During his tenure with the Thunder, Donovan worked closely with star players such as Russell Westbrook and Kevin Durant. He led the team to the playoffs in each of his first four seasons, showcasing his adaptability and strategic acumen. Despite the challenges of managing a roster with high expectations, Donovan proved his ability to compete at the highest level.
Chicago Bulls
In 2020, Donovan joined the Chicago Bulls as their head coach, bringing his expertise to a franchise in need of revitalization. Under his guidance, the Bulls have shown signs of improvement, with a focus on developing young talent and fostering a winning culture.
